OKRs stand for “Objectives and Key Results.” It is a collaborative goal-setting methodology used by the best tech and innovative companies to set challenging, ambitious goals with measurable results. OKRs are how you track progress, create alignment, and encourage engagement around measurable goals. OKRs are an effective goal-setting and leadership tool for communicating what you want to accomplish and what milestones you’ll need to meet in order to accomplish it.
